Start your training for Ride for the Pass, happening on Saturday, May 17th. At this 31st year of the event you can ride up the pass (sun or snow) with no vehicles on the road. The event benefits Independence Pass Foundation which works so hard to take care of our pass. A barbecue + raffle will follow the ride at the winter gate (weather permitting).
As more people access the backcountry, learning how to safely and responsibly spend time in these spaces is a critical part of being prepared. Join Aspen Public Radio and The Arts Campus at Willits (TACAW) on Saturday, May 17, 2025 from 11: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. for the Roaring Fork Valley’s second annual Backcountry Symposium.
This FREE event will convene local and visiting backcountry enthusiasts. Register now to be entered into a drawing for amazing backcountry gear and prizes!
Beginning with a Resource Fair of area organizations and businesses working in outdoor education and adventure, the day will include a series of panel discussions and presentations exploring the backcountry, sharing key resources and tools for understanding the season ahead and the demands of these spaces, with lots of storytelling and some of the history of going backcountry in our region.
